I'm not familiar with the guys up in Bethesda....but the HUGE selling point for me on The GTT was you actually hit balls into a range--not a net.

 

If memory serves, GTT charges about $150 for irons and woods that gets credited towards a purchase. They'll even let you break it up into 2 sessions...heck I spent about 6-7 hours all told for both.

 

They will definitely tweak anything you bring them...I've taken them irons, putters and woods and they've taken care of me every time.

They guys in Bethesda are real nice...however its $250 for the consult, and no monies applied toward purchase. Its a big Fuji shop last I was in, and you are hitting indoors. Their reptuations are very good though.

 

Westfields I heard good things about too.

 

This newer place sounds interesting and i have spoken with the operator, Mike Fix. Check out highlaunchgolf.com. He operates out of the Gauntlet in Fredericksburg. USes 2 trackmans"s and has about every new shaft you can think of from Epic Ozik Whiteboard, and eveything in between. Out door range and prices are reasonable even if you just want to calibrate your wedges and not get fitted for product.

Wade Heintzelman at The Golf Care Center in Bethesda, MD: (301) 652-6094. Wade's brother was a Tour pro, and Wade himself continues to fit several Tour pros when they come to the area. His services go way beyond loft, lie and shaft flex: he'll consider swingweight, grip size, and other details that can make all the difference.
